Background
Rootines, developed by ASD.ai LLC, is a patient engagement platform designed to support individuals with pediatric complex chronic conditions. Established in 2020 and headquartered in Red Oak, Texas, Rootines aims to enhance the well-being of neurodiverse individuals by providing tools for caregivers and healthcare professionals to monitor and manage daily routines effectively. The platform's mission is to improve patient outcomes through continuous data collection and analysis, facilitating early intervention and personalized care plans.
Key Strategic Focus
Rootines specializes in developing mobile applications and web portals that enable caregivers to track various aspects of an individual's daily routine, including mood, medication adherence, sleep patterns, and hydration. By leveraging artificial intelligence and machine learning, the platform identifies insights that might otherwise be missed, thereby enhancing patient engagement and care. The primary markets targeted include hospitals, therapy centers, and healthcare clinics, with a focus on conditions such as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D),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D), bipolar disorder, and other mental health disorders.
Financials and Funding
In September 2021, ASD.ai secured a $1 million angel investment from Determined Capital LLC, founded by Tim Davis. This funding was allocated for key hires and further product development, including the completion of a web portal to support business-to-business applications and commercial users such as therapists' offices and hospitals. Prior to this investment, ASD.ai was a recipient of a Microsoft for Startups grant.
Pipeline Development
Rootines has expanded its platform to include support for various conditions:
-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D): The initial focus of the platform, providing tools for caregivers to monitor and manage daily routines.
- Mental Health: In July 2022, Rootines added mental health tracking capabilities, allowing users to monitor mood, sleep, diet, and other factors affecting mental well-being.
-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U) Follow-Up: Announced in August 2022, this solution enables tracking of feeding, weight, oxygen therapy, and medication for infants discharged from the NICU, as well as monitoring parental stress to provide additional support.
Technological Platform and Innovation
Rootines distinguishes itself through its integration of artificial intelligence and machine learning to analyze patient-reported outcomes and remote patient monitoring data. The platform's proprietary technologies include:
- Data Collection and Analysis: Utilizing AI and machine learning algorithms to identify patterns and insights from daily routine data.
- Remote Patient Monitoring: Integrating with smart devices to collect real-time health data, such as weight and sleep quality.
- EMR/EHR Integration: Offering seamless integration with electronic medical records to streamline data sharing and enhance clinical workflows.
Leadership Team
The executive team at ASD.ai comprises:
- Tamera Jackson (TJ), CEO: Co-founder and Chief Executive Officer, leading the company's strategic vision and operations.
- Blake Rutherford, CMO: Co-founder and Chief Medical Officer, overseeing medical strategy and product development.
- Dominic Foster, CTO: Co-founder and Chief Technology Officer, responsible for technological innovation and infrastructure.
- Jerome Pascua, Senior VP of Software: Leading software development and design initiatives.
